Arcgis中将jpg删格数据矢量化为shp

转自:https://zhidao.baidu.com/question/438923036465979932.html

在ArcGIS中将jpg格式的栅格数据矢量化为shp格式,可按照以下步骤操作:

一、前期处理

  • 单色化处理:使用Photoshop将水系等目标要素调整为单色(如纯黑或纯白),输出为jpg或png格式。此步骤旨在简化栅格数据结构,便于后续分类提取。

    image

     

二、数据加载与显示调整

  • 加载数据:在ArcMap中通过黑色十字的“添加”按钮导入处理后的图片,避免使用文件条的“插入”功能。
  • 显示优化:若图片缩放后不显示,右键图层选择“属性”→“符号系统”→“拉伸”,尝试切换黑白色带,确保水域显示为黑色。若仍不显示,右键图层选择“缩放至图层”。

    image

三、栅格重分类

  • 操作路径:打开“工具箱”→“3D Analyst Tools”→“栅格重分类”→“重分类”。
  • 参数设置

    在“分类”选项中选择类别数为2。

    调整分类值,使第一个值靠近右侧,这样重分类后划分进1的值会多一些,后面矢量化的效果会好些。

  • 结果验证:重分类后界面会显示二值化结果,目标要素(如水系)应被归类为同一值(如1)。

    image

     

    image

     

    image

     

     

四、按属性提取

  • 操作路径:选择“工具箱”→“Spatial Analyst Tools”→“提取分析”→“按属性提取”。
  • 参数设置

    将重分类后的栅格数据拖入“输入栅格”。

    点击“where字句”右侧的SQL图标,输入条件“value=1”并确定。

  • 结果验证:提取后目标要素(如水系)应被单独分离出来。

    image

     

    image

     

    image

     

五、栅格转矢量

  • 操作路径:选择“工具箱”→“Conversion Tools”→“由栅格转出”→“栅格转面”。
  • 参数设置:直接运行工具,无需额外参数调整。
  • 结果验证:转换后生成shp格式的矢量数据,需检查拓扑错误(如面重叠、缝隙等)。

    image

     

    image

     

posted @ 2026-02-04 10:55  追梦百合fly  阅读(16)  评论(0)    收藏  举报